Public bug reported:
I'm using Linux Mint 17. In the Gnome Terminal when hitting
Ctrl+Backspace just one character is being deleted (^H). In normal Gtk+
applications this key combination deletes the previous word (Ctrl+W) in
Bash. There's also no way for Bash to distinguish between Ctrl+Backspace

To do the LTS upgrade if you know about this before, this is enough:
sudo apt-get purge tex-common
sudo -E do-release-upgrade -d
sudo -E apt-get -y install tex-common texlive-base texlive-latex-recommended
(last packages added back as you need)
